The Algorithms: Zig

This project aims at showcasing common algorithms implemented in Zig, with an accent on idiomatic code and genericity.

Project structure

Every project is managed by the build.zig file.

To add a new algorithm you only need to categorize and pass the exact location of the new file.

e.g.:

// build.zig
// new algorithm
if (std.mem.eql(u8, op, "category/algorithm-name"))
    buildAlgorithm(b, .{
        .optimize = optimize,
        .target = target,
        .name = "algorithm-src.zig",
        .category = "category",
    });

to test add:

// runall.zig
try runTest(allocator, "category/algorithm-name");

Note: Do not change or modify the files (build.zig & runall.zig) without first suggesting it to the maintainers (open/issue proposal).
